Illegal moneylending gang: Builder paid ₹36.5 lakh after ₹5 lakh loan; farmland grabbed

Lokmat News Network

Chhatrapati Sambhajinagar

An illegal moneylending gang allegedly trapped a builder by lending Rs 5 lakh at 10% monthly interest, later extorting Rs 16 lakh as interest within five months and demanding another Rs 16.5 lakh, besides grabbing 2.5 acres of farmland.

The accused also allegedly kidnapped the builder three times, confined him in a closed company at Chikalthana, assaulted him and demanded Rs 25 lakh to return the land. The accused are Lakhan Sable (33), Vicky Shinde (33) of Brijwadi, Prashant Dhakne (32, Vitthalnagar), and Venkatesh Dhage (28, Bharatnagar). A case has been registered against the five-member gang at the Pundliknagar police station. Complainant builder Vishwajit Deshmukh (29) of N-4 said he met Lakhan Sable in 2024 during construction work at his brother’s house. In April 2024, Sable lent him Rs 5 lakh, taking four blank cheques and signed bond papers. Within five months, Rs 16 lakh interest was recovered, after which the gang allegedly began further blackmail for Rs 16.5 lakh.

-----

Confined in a company at Chikalthana

On December 5, 2024, the accused allegedly forced Deshmukh into a car and took him to Kannad, pressuring him to transfer his Karanjkhed farmland in Dhage’s name. After he refused, he was confined in a Chikalthana company and threatened at knife-point.

-----

Harassment continued even after cheques

Under pressure, Deshmukh transferred the land. Later, his father paid Rs 16 lakh through two cheques, deposited in the account of Pravin Mokale, after Sable promised to cancel the deal in writing. However, the accused again demanded Rs 25 lakh, claiming Dhage had absconded. Vicky Shinde also threatened Deshmukh’s father and extorted Rs 4.5 lakh, besides threatening to file an atrocity case and kidnap the builder’s son.

-----

Builder approaches police

Fed up with the harassment, Deshmukh approached police. Pundliknagar police arrested Lakhan Sable and Vicky Shinde on Wednesday night, under the supervision of police inspector Ashok Bhandare and assistant police inspector Shivprasad Karhale.
